expression="execution(*service..*.*(..))"

(* com.evan.crm.service.*.*(..))中几个通配符的含义: 


|第一个 * —— 通配 随便率性返回值类型| 
|第二个 * —— 通配包com.evan.crm.service下的随便率性class| 
|第三个 * —— 通配包com.evan.crm.service下的随便率性class的随便率性办法| 
|第四个 .. —— 通配 办法可以有0个或多个参数| 


 

 

 
 

 
 

还有一个 
execution (* com.cms.art.service.*.*(..))" 

要怎么写?

可以这样写:将execution分开写。 
 
or (execution (* com.cms.art.service.*.*(..)))" />
 
 

老外喜欢吧逻辑运算符用or,and !写,国内一般用|| && !。

你可能感兴趣的:(expression="execution(*service..*.*(..))")